A group of state lawmakers is urging the Minnesota Public Utilities Commission to deny BlackRock's controversial bid to take over Minnesota Power, saying among other things that "the risks and harms would outweigh the minimal, short-term benefits" efiling.web.commerce.state.mn.us/documents/%7...
October 1, 2025 at 7:10 PM
Proponents of BlackRock's takeover of Minnesota Power like to note the state Dept of Commerce supports the deal. But AG Ellison's office and others say many of the provisions that got Commerce on board are either already required or provide no benefit efiling.web.commerce.state.mn.us/documents/%7...

It's been over 10 years since Xcel Energy and CenterPoint Energy signed agreements to help advance the City of Minneapolis' clean energy goals yet a new report shows they're still way behind on every metric except the ones the city most fully controls mplscleanenergypartnership.org/documents/20...

Legislators who represent Minnesota Power's hometown of Duluth urged state regulators to reject a private equity proposal to buy the utility, saying the deal "poses significant risks to Minnesota Power ratepayers, employees, and the public at large" efiling.web.commerce.state.mn.us/documents/%7...
August 20, 2025 at 8:59 PM
It appears that a lawyer for the private equity group trying to buy Minnesota Power rewrote labor unions' comments to strengthen their support for the controversial deal. This lawyer is also a former Minnesota utility regulator. As noted by @curemn.org: www.edockets.state.mn.us/submissions/...

Minnesota regulators approved CenterPoint's plan to inflate customer-funded rebates for gas furnaces over the objections of climate and consumer advocates. The decision cites supportive comments from appliance installers and others, including those apparently ghostwritten by a CenterPoint lobbyist.
